How Spaced Repetition Works

Spaced repetition is based on the concept that memories are more likely to be retained if they are reviewed at increasing intervals. This process mimics the way our brain naturally encodes information.
When we learn something new, it is initially stored in short-term memory. Over time, if the information is not actively recalled, it begins to fade away. However, by spacing out the repetitions at gradually increasing intervals, we reinforce the memory and push it into long-term storage.

Implementing Spaced Repetition
There are several methods for implementing spaced repetition:
- Physical flashcards: Create flashcards with the question on one side and the answer on the other. Review the flashcards at increasing intervals (e.g., 10 minutes, 1 hour, 1 day).
- Software applications: Use software or apps that provide spaced repetition functionality, such as Anki or SuperMemo.
- Concept mapping: Create a hierarchical diagram that connects concepts and ideas. Regularly review the map to recall the information.

FAQs
What is spaced repetition?
Spaced repetition is a learning technique where you review information at increasing intervals to strengthen memory retention. By repeatedly recalling information from your memory, you force your brain to make an effort to retrieve it, which reinforces the memory and makes it more resistant to forgetting.
Why is spaced repetition effective?
Spaced repetition capitalizes on the forgetting curve, which shows that we tend to forget information quickly after learning it. By reviewing information before we forget it completely, we can prevent the memory from fading and strengthen it over time.
How often should I use spaced repetition?
The optimal interval between reviews depends on the difficulty of the material and your individual learning style. However, a common recommendation is to review information within 24 hours, then again a few days later, and then at increasing intervals (e.g., a week, a month, etc.).

Forgetting Curve
The forgetting curve illustrates the natural decline in memory retention over time. It shows that the most significant forgetting occurs shortly after learning, and the rate of forgetting gradually decreases with time. Spaced repetition helps to counter this forgetting curve by actively retrieving information and preventing it from fading.
Active Recall
Active recall is a critical component of spaced repetition. It involves actively trying to recall information from memory without looking at your notes. This process forces your brain to work harder, strengthening the memory trace and making it more resistant to forgetting.
Retrieval Cues
Retrieval cues are cues or prompts that help you retrieve information from memory. They can be images, keywords, questions, or anything that helps you access the memory you’re trying to recall. Spaced repetition incorporates retrieval cues into the review process to facilitate active recall.
Interleaving
Interleaving is the technique of mixing up different types of information during your review sessions. Instead of reviewing similar concepts in blocks, you interleave them, which helps to strengthen connections between different pieces of information and improves overall retention.
Feedback
Feedback is essential for effective spaced repetition. It allows you to assess your progress, identify areas where you need additional review, and adjust your intervals accordingly. Spaced repetition systems typically provide feedback through quizzes, self-assessments, or error tracking.
